Output 63196d0d979eee9360b456562b09b28f4328aa5c0026c7556c3af0a0c9b8ad72:0

value
28932598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e638a9b1505549d85c63515a64dae635a0570c OP_EQUAL
address
3JpY5UWacYz2UPKTnXXzcXqqEtJNUBrn46
transaction
63196d0d979eee9360b456562b09b28f4328aa5c0026c7556c3af0a0c9b8ad72
confirmations
406310
spent
true